SIZES
To fit infant 3 (6-12) mos.
GAUGE
14 sc and 15 rows = 4 ins [10 cm].
MATERIALS
Bernat® Handicrafter Cotton
(50 g / 1.75 oz/73 m/80 yds)
or Bernat® Satin
(100 g / 3.5 oz/149 m/163 yds)
Sizes: 3 mos (6 mos-12mos)
50 (75-90) m
OR
55 (85-100) yds
Size 4 mm (U.S. G or 6) crochet hook or size needed to obtain gauge.
INSTRUCTIONS
The instructions are written for smallest
size. If changes are necessary for larger sizes
the instructions will be written thus ( ).
Cuff: Ch 16.
1st row: 1 sc in 2nd ch from hook. 1 sc
in each ch to end of ch. Turn. 15 sc.
2nd row: Ch 1. Working in back
loops only, 1 sc in each sc across.
Rep last row until work from beg
measures 6 (6¼-6½) ins [15 (16-16.5)
cm], ending with a RS row. Do not
turn.
Foot: 1st row: (RS). Ch 1. Work 23
(25-27) sc evenly along long edge of
Cuff. Turn.
2nd row: Ch 1. 1 sc in each sc across.
Fasten off.
Instep: 1st row: With RS of work
facing, miss first 7 (8-9) sc. Join yarn
with sl st to next sc. Ch 1. 1 sc in same
sp as last
sl st. 1 sc in each of next 8 sc. Turn.
Leave rem sts unworked. 9 sc.
2nd to 4th rows: Ch 1. 1 sc in each sc
across. Turn.
5th row: Ch 1. Draw up a loop in each
of next 2 sts. Yoh and draw through all
3 loops on hook – sc2tog made. 1 sc in
each of next 5 sts. Sc2tog over next
2 sts. 7 sts. Fasten off.
Sew back seam.
Foot: 1st rnd: With RS of work
facing, join yarn with sl st at center
back. Ch 2 (counts as hdc). 1 hdc in
each of next 6 (7-8) sts, 7 hdc down
side of instep, 2 hdc in corner sc, 5 hdc
across end of instep, 2 hdc in corner
sc, 7 hdc along other side of instep, 1
hdc in each of next 7 (8-9) sts. Join
with sl st in top of ch 2. 37 (39-41)
hdc.
2nd rnd: Ch 2 (counts as hdc). *Yoh
and draw up a loop around post of next
st at back of work inserting hook from
right to left. (Yoh and draw through
2 loops on hook) twice – 1 dcbp made.
Rep from * around. Join with sl st to
top of ch 2.
3rd rnd: As 2nd rnd.
4th rnd: Ch 1. Sc2tog over first 2 sts.
1 sc in each of next 14 (15-16) sts.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in next st.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in each of
next 14 (15-16) sts. Sc2tog over last
2 sts. Join with sl st to first st. 33 (35-
37) sc.
5th rnd: Ch 1. Sc2tog over first 2 sts.
1 sc in each of next 12 (13-14) sc.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in next sc.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in each of
next 12 (13-14) sc. Sc2tog over last
2 sts. Join with sl st to first st. 29 (31-
33) sts.
6th rnd: Ch 1. Sc2tog over first 2 sts.
1 sc in each of next 10 (11-12) sc.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in next sc.
Sc2tog over next 2 sts. 1 sc in each of
next 10 (11-12) sc. Sc2tog over last
2 sts. Join with sl st to first st. 25 (27-
29) sts.
7th rnd: Ch 1. Sc2tog over first 2 sts.
1 sc in each of next 8 (9-10) sc. Sc2tog
over next 2 sts. 1 sc in next sc. Sc2tog
over next 2 sts. 1 sc in each of next
8 (9-10) sc. Sc2tog over last 2 sts. Join
with sl st to first st. 21 (23-25) sts.
Fasten off.
Sew sole seam.
